# hardware/transmitter.py
from pymodbus.exceptions import ModbusException
class TransmitterController:
def __init__(self, relay_controller):
self.relay_controller = relay_controller
# 变送器配置
self.config = {
1: { # 上料斗
'slave_id': 1,
'weight_register': 0x01,
'register_count': 2
},
2: { # 下料斗
'slave_id': 2,
'weight_register': 0x01,
'register_count': 2
}
}
def read_data_back(self, transmitter_id):
"""读取变送器数据"""
try:
if transmitter_id not in self.config:
print(f"无效变送器ID: {transmitter_id}")
return None
config = self.config[transmitter_id]
if not self.relay_controller.modbus_client.connect():
print("无法连接网络继电器Modbus服务")
return None
result = self.relay_controller.modbus_client.read_holding_registers(
address=config['weight_register'],
count=config['register_count'],
slave=config['slave_id']
)
if isinstance(result, Exception):
print(f"读取变送器 {transmitter_id} 失败: {result}")
return None
# 根据图片示例,正确解析数据
if config['register_count'] == 2:
# 获取原始字节数组
raw_data = result.registers
# 组合成32位整数
weight = (raw_data[0] << 16) + raw_data[1]
weight = weight / 1000.0 # 单位转换为千克
elif config['register_count'] == 1:
weight = float(result.registers[0])
else:
print(f"不支持的寄存器数量: {config['register_count']}")
return None
print(f"变送器 {transmitter_id} 读取重量: {weight}kg")
return weight
except ModbusException as e:
print(f"Modbus通信错误: {e}")
return None
except Exception as e:
print(f"数据解析错误: {e}")
return None
finally:
self.relay_controller.modbus_client.close()
# 直接读取 变送器返回的数据
def read_data(self, transmitter_id):
"""
Args: transmitter_id 为1 表示上料斗, 为2 表示下料斗
return: 读取成功返回重量 weight: int, 失败返回 None
"""
if transmitter_id == 1:
# 上料斗变送器的信息:
IP = "192.168.250.63"
PORT = 502
TIMEOUT = 5 # 超时时间为 5秒
weight = None
import socket
with socket.socket(socket.AF_INET, socket.SOCK_STREAM) as s:
try:
s.settimeout(TIMEOUT)
s.connect((IP, PORT))
print(f"✅ 连接 {IP}:{PORT} 成功")
# 接收数据变送器主动推送单次recv即可获取一条完整数据
data = s.recv(1024)
if data:
# print(f"收到原始数据:{data}")
weight = self.parse_weight(data)
else:
print("❌ 未收到设备数据")
except ConnectionRefusedError:
print(f"❌ 连接失败:{IP}:{PORT} 拒绝连接(设备离线/端口错误)")
except socket.timeout:
print(f"❌ 超时:{TIMEOUT}秒内未收到数据")
except Exception as e:
print(f"❌ 读取异常:{e}")
# 成功返回重量int失败返回None
return weight
def parse_weight(raw_data):
"""解析函数:提取重量数值(如从 b'ST,NT,+0000175\r\n' 中提取 175)"""
try:
data_str = raw_data.decode('utf-8').strip()
parts = data_str.split(',')
weight_part = parts[2].strip()
return int(''.join(filter(str.isdigit, weight_part)))
except (IndexError, ValueError, UnicodeDecodeError) as e:
# print(f"数据解析失败:{e},原始数据:{raw_data}")
# 注意可能会出现解析失败的情况此时返回None界面不用更新数据就行
return None
